My favourite is Nigella's recipe in Feast. It's always worth checking with a blade or stick before you think they're ready and really it's personal preference for how gooey you like them in the middle, with the Nigella ones they definitely need to have cracked on top. Also they can cook a little more once you take them out although not much. Plus your oven can make a difference. So yeah check early and then just do 3-5 minute intervals until the knife comes out slightly gooey or clean. But obviously the cleaner it is the more cakey they will be.
